WELCOME HOME to 23822 Green Haven Lane! This stunning 3-bedroom, 2.5-bath condo is beautifully updated and truly move-in ready. The bright, open kitchen features elegant granite countertops, a stylish backsplash, and newer stainless steel appliances. Downstairs, you’ll find beautiful LVP flooring throughout, a cozy living room fireplace, and large windows showcasing peaceful backyard views. The spacious dining area seamlessly connects to the kitchen and living room—perfect for entertaining family and friends. A convenient half bath and laundry room complete the first floor. Upstairs, enjoy three generous bedrooms, including an oversized primary suite with pool views, a walk-in closet, and a luxurious walk-in shower. Step outside to your private, fully fenced backyard with mature landscaping and direct access to the lush greenbelt. Just beyond your gate, the community pool and spa await for year-round enjoyment. A one-car garage and an additional covered carport space are included. Ideally located within walking distance of the community pocket park, San Diego Country Estates Golf Resort, the Par Lounge, and the Oaks Grille—with hiking and biking trails right across the street. Despite being built in 1975, this property has undergone extensive and high-quality renovations, making it truly move-in ready. The kitchen features modern white shaker cabinets, elegant granite countertops, a stylish subway tile backsplash, and newer stainless steel appliances. Bathrooms are also updated with modern vanities, fixtures, and a luxurious walk-in shower in the primary. Beautiful LVP flooring downstairs and clean, neutral carpet upstairs contribute to a fresh aesthetic. Recessed lighting and modern light fixtures are present throughout. While not a new build, the significant updates place it firmly in the 'Good' category, indicating a well-maintained home with recent renovations (likely within the last 5-15 years) that require no immediate repairs or updates.
